In "The Story of Britain," bestselling writer and broadcaster Andrew Marr presents a compelling history of Britain during Queen Elizabeth II's reign, illustrating the profound changes that defined modern Britain since 1953. Through the lens of influential figures—from activists and artists to sports heroes and innovators—Marr explores the contributions that shaped the nation's identity and values. This engaging narrative reflects on the legacy of the Elizabethan Age, prompting listeners to consider how our generation might be remembered in the future. Featuring notable personalities like David Attenborough and Marcus Rashford, it offers both entertaining insights and a rich understanding of Britain's evolution.
